An internationally renowned destination for transplant care and one of the largest in the nation
Baylor Scott & White Annette C. and Harold C. Simmons Transplant Institute at Baylor Scott & White All Saints Medical Center – Fort Worth and Baylor University Medical Center, part of Baylor Scott & White Health is one of the busiest multi-specialty transplant centers in the world.
We have performed more than 2,300 transplants to date—including more than 633 liver transplants and 1,595 kidney transplants—making us the highest volume transplant center in Fort Worth. We also offer convenient outreach locations in Lubbock and Amarillo for kidney transplant appointments. In addition, we have liver outreach clinics in Amarillo, Lubbock, and Odessa for patients with liver conditions such as cirrhosis, hepatitis, and fatty liver as well as other complex liver issues including alcohol related liver disease.

Transplant programs in Fort Worth
At Baylor Scott & White All Saints – Fort Worth, we provide liver, kidney, living donor kidney, islet cell and pancreas transplants.

FitSTEPS for Life
FitSTEPS for Life is an exercise program developed to tailor exercise to patient’s specific diagnosis and physical capabilities. The program was initially designed for cancer patients. More recently, patients with liver disease were added to this program.
FitSTEPS for Life operates in multiple locations in the Dallas-Fort Worth area including the Baylor University Medical Center. The program permits patients to benefit from a gym-like experience for free.
Note: This program is currently on hold due to COVID-19
Affordable temporary housing for transplant patients
Twice Blessed House is dedicated to serving pre- and post-transplant patients and their caregivers by providing a warm family atmosphere and amenities needed for daily living. Twice Blessed House (TBH) offers patients and their caregivers temporary and affordable housing during the entire transplant process.
